Well I finally found a new ride for me. After looking at several options and a couple of set backs, I have finally got a new to me Marauder.

It's an Silver Birch 300B Charcoal Interior jsut under 60k and has a Trunk Organizer, Dynotech Metal Matrix Driveshaft, Denso Iridium Spark Plugs Addco Front and Rear Sway Bars, Precision Industries 3000 rpm Torque Converter, Marauder Rear Engine Cooling Kit, 4.10 Gears, 180 Degree Thermostat, Marauder Level 2 Transmission Kit (built for 650 hp), Art Carr Deep Transmission Kit, Transmission Cooler w/Braided Lines, working AutoMeter Oil pressure and Transmission Temp Gauges, KOOKS Long Tube SS Headers (jet coated), High Flow cats, X Pipe, Magnaflow Mufflers, Exhaust Tips lengthened, K&N cold air kit, Gods Head badges on hood, trunk, steering wheel, Pro Guard rear skid plate, Metco Control arms BFG g-Force T/A KDW-2 tires Rr, Goodyear F1 supercar tires in the front, Formula 1 Lifetime window tint, Diff Cover Stud Girdle, Silverstar Ultra Head and fog lights, Aluminum Custom Dead Pedal, Aluminum Marauder door sills, and the lower grill modification (not sure what this is). Also has a custom tune and comes with the tuner. The car dynoed at 350Hp and 360 ft/lb torque. Not sure if this is flywheel or rear wheels. I am assuming at the wheels even if its not I'm happy.
